Coffins Maker In Mombasa Gets Punched By A Customer For Saying This

“Thank You and welcome back again” these are common and magic words used as courtesy by many businessmen to a  customer,however as Isaac a carpenter specialising in coffins making in Mombasa realised,they are the wrong words to use in his business.
Having lost his mom,the said customer was not amused when the carpenter saw him off with,”thank you for buying coffin from me,welcome back again” Ideally what that meant was for another of his relatives to die so he could get back to buy another coffin from him.
What followed was not a smile but a heavy punch that landed on his cheeks causing a ramble on his jaws. You just don’t want to say certain words to a grieving man clearly.
